da

prefix:

  • poor; low-grade; trivial; insignificant; worthless 駄文

suffix noun / counter:

  • load; pack; horse load 一駄

noun:

  • packhorse

Kanji definition:

DATA

burdensome; pack horse; horse load; send by horse; trivial; worthless

Strokes:
14
Radical:
馬 horse
SKIP:
1-10-4
UTF:
99c4
JIS208:
34-44
Hangul:
태 [tae]타 [ta]
Pinyin:
tuó / duò
Stroke order:
Alternative stroke order:
Example words:
下駄げたgeta
geta; Japanese wooden clogs; / turn (in set-type proofing); upside-down character
無駄むだmuda
futility; waste; uselessness; pointlessness; idleness
無駄遣いむだづかいmudazukai
waste (of money, time, etc.); squandering; frittering away
駄菓子屋だがしやdagashiya
small-time candy store
駄菓子だがしdagashi
cheap sweets
